1
Изобретение относится к вычислительной технике и может быть использовано при организации обмена между периферийными устройствами.
Известно приоритетное устройство, содержащее поразрядные логические узлы элементы И, ИЛИ,И-НЕ Г1 .
Однако такое устройство не позволяет изменять установленный порядок опроса источников информации.
Известно устройство приоритета,. содержащее два регистра, блок управления, элементы И, ИЛИ Г21.
Недостатком такого устройства является то, что при большом числе абонентов время подключения менее приоритетных абонентов значительно увеличивается.
Цель изобретения - расширение функциональных возможностей.
Поставленная цель достигается тем, что в устройство приоритета, содержащее два п-разрядных регистра, группу элементов И и блок управления, содержащий первый элемент И, первый элемент ИЛИ, сдвиговый регистр, причем единичные входы триггеров первого регистра соединены с соответствующим запросным входом устройства и с соответствуюищми входами первого элемента ИЛИ блока управления, единичный выход триггера каждого разряда первого регистра соединен с первым . входом соответствующего элемента И группы, второй вход каждого элемента И первого регистра соединен с соответствующим выходом сдвигового регистра блока управления, выход каждого элемента И группы соединен с единичным входом соответствующего триггера второго регистра, единичный выход каждого триггера второго регистра соединен с соответствующим выходом устройства, нулевой выход каждого триггера второго регистра соединен с соответствующим входом первого элемента И блока управления, введены в блок управления второй элемент И, второй, третий элементы ИЛИ,триггер режимов, триггер управления, причем выходы элементов.и группы соединены с соответствующими входами второго элемента ИЛИ блока управления и с нулевыми входами соответствующих триггеров первого регистра, выход второго элемента ИЛИ блока управления соединен с нулевым входом триггера управления, с первым входом второго элемента И блока управления,
управляйЩий вход устройства соединен с соответствующим входом первого элемента ИЛИ блока управления и с нулевыми входами триггеров второго регистра, тактовый вход устройства соединен с тактовым входом сдвигового регистра, управляющий вход сдвигового регистра соединен с выходом триггера управления, вход сброса сдвигового регистра соединен с выходом третьего элемента ИЛИ блока управления, вход режимов устройства соединен с единичным входом триггера режимов, , выход триггера режимов соединен со вторым входом второго элемента И блока управления,выход второго элемента И блока управления соединен с первым входов третьего элемента ИЛИ блока управления,второ вход третьего элемента ИЛИ блока управлениясоединен с последним выходом сдвигового регистра, выход первого элемента ИЛИ блока управления соединен с соответствующим входом первого элемента И блока управления.
Схема устройства представлена на чертеже.
Схема содержит первый регистр 1, второй регистр 2, блок 3 управления триггеры 4 первого регистра, элементы и 5 первого регистра, триггеры второго регистра 6, сдвиговый регистр 7, элементы ИЛИ 8-10, элементы И 11,12,триггер 13 управления триггер 14 режимов, запросные входы 1-5 устройства, управляющий вход 16, тактовый вход 17, выходы 18 устройства, вход .19 режимов.
Устройство приоритета работает следующим образом.
Устройство работает в двух режимах. Режимы работы устройства определяются состоянием триггеров 14 ре ма. При нулевом состоянии триггера
14(в режиме последовательного опроса) после снятия запроса на обслуживание отработавшего абонента сигнал опроса распространяется на следующий канал, подключенный к менее приоритетному абоненту.
При единичном состоянии триггера 14 (в режиме приоритетного опроса) после снятия запроса на обслуживание отработавшего абонента опрос начинается е канала, подключенного к абоненту с на.ивысшим приоритетом. В обоих режимах приоритет каналов определяется порядком их очередност т.е. первый канал обладает высшим приоритетом.
При поступлении запросов на вход
15устройства соответствующие триггеры 4 регистра 1 устанавливаются в единичное состояние и через элементы ИЛИ 8, И 11 устанавливается в единичное состояние триггер 13 а на его единичном выходе формирует потенциал, который поступает на
управляющий вход сдвигового регистра 7, и при поступлении тактовых импульсов на тактовый вход 17 устройства на выходах сдвигающего регистра 7 вырабатыйаются сигналы опро. са. Они поступают на входы элементов Л 5 регистра 1. Если .триггер 4 регистра 1 находится в единичном состоянии, то на выходе элемента И 5 появляется сигнал, который сформиfL рует на единичном выходе триггера 6
регистра 2 сигнал разрешения на обслуживание абонента, подключенного ко входу 15 устройства. Одновременно на нулевом входе триггера 13 через элемент ИЛИ 9 появляется сигнал,
5 который сбрасывает триггер в нулевое состояние. Снимается сигнал управления/ поступающий на управляющий вход сдвигового регистра 7. Прекращается выработка сигналов на его выходах и останавливается опрос регистра 1.В режиме последовательного обслуживания триггер 14 находится в нулевом состоянии. После окончания обслуживания по сигналу с управляющего входа 16 сбрасывается триггер 6 и снимается сигнал разрешения на обслуживание. Одновременно элемент ИЛИ 8 триггер 13 устанавливаетQ ся в единичное состояние, запускается сдвигающий регистр 7 и продолжается опрос следующего триггера регистра 1. Когда сигнал опроса вырабатывается на последнем выходе сдвиC гающего регистра 7, то через элемент ИЛИ 10 он поступает на вход Сброс сдвигающего регистра 7 .и возвращает его в исходное состояние.
в режиме приоритетного обслуживания триггер 14 режимов устанавливается в единичное состояние. С единичного выхода этого триггера на вход элемента И 12 поступает разрешение на прохождение сигнала с элемента ИЛИ 9, который сбрасывает
сдвигающий регистр .7 в исходное состояние, т.е. после окончания обслуживания абонента опрос вновь начнется с первого более приоритетного канала.
Применение предложенного изобретения позволяет устройству расширить функциональные возможности путем введения с помощью триггера режимов последовательного и приоритетного опроса абонентов.
Формула изобретения
Устройство приоритета, содержащее два п-разрядных регистра,группу элементов И и блок управления,содержащий первый элемент И, первый элемент ИЛИ, сдвиговый регистр, причем
единичные входы триггеров первого регистра соединены с соответствующим запросным входом устройства, и с соответствующими входами первого элемента ИЛИ блока управления,единичный выход триггера каждого разряда первого регистра соединен с пермым входом соответствующего элемен- -та И группы, второй вход каждого элемента И группы соединен с соответствующим выходом сдвигового регистра блока управления, выход каждого элемента И группы соединен с единичным входом соответствующего .второго регистра, единичный выход каждого триггера второго регистра соединен с соответствующим выходом устройства, нулевой выход каждого триггера второго регистра соединен с соответствующим входом первого элемента И блока управления, отличающееся тем, что, с целью расширения функциональныхвозможностей за счет обеспечения работы как в последовательном, так и в приоритетном режимах опроса абонентов, устройство содержит в блоке .управления второй элемент И, второй, третий элементы ИЛИ, триггер режимов, триггер управления, причем выходы элементов И группы соединены с соответствующими входами второго элемента ИЛИ блока управления и с нулевыми входами соответствующих триггеров первого регистра, выход второго элемента ИЛИ блока управления соедйнен с нулевым входом триггера управления и с первым входом второго элемента И блока управления, управляющий вход устройства соединен с соответствующим входом первого элемента ИЛИ блока управления и с нулевыми входами триггеров второго регистра,тактовый вход устройства соединен с тактовьгм входом сдвигового регистра, управляющий вход сдвигового регистра соединен с выходом триггера управ0ления, вход сброса сдвигового регистра соединен с выходом третьего элемента ИЛИ. блока управления, вход режимов устройства соединен с единичным входом триггера режимов, выход
5 триггера режимов соединен со вторым входом второго элемента И блока управления, выход второго элемента И блока управления соединен с первым входом третьего элемента ИЛИ блока управления, второй вход третьего
0 элемента ИЛИ блока управления соединен с последним выходом сдвигового регистра, выход первого элемента ИЛИ блока управления соединен с соответствующим входом первого элемента И
5 блока управления.
Источники информации, принятые во внимание при экспертизе
1.Авторское свидетельство СССР
0 № 474807, кл. G 06 F 9/18, 1976.
2.Авторское свидетельство СССР № 600557, кл. 6 06 F 9/18,1978 (прототип).
название | год | авторы | номер документа |
---|---|---|---|
Устройство динамического приоритета | 1987 |
|
SU1464158A1 |
Устройство переменного приоритета | 1986 |
|
SU1319033A1 |
Приоритетное устройство | 1984 |
|
SU1260956A1 |
Устройство для обслуживания запросов | 1978 |
|
SU728128A1 |
Устройство для приоритетного опроса | 1983 |
|
SU1105894A1 |
Устройство для обработки запросов | 1988 |
|
SU1580365A1 |
Устройство циклического приоритета | 1990 |
|
SU1764054A1 |
Устройство для приоритетного обслуживания заявок | 1990 |
|
SU1695301A1 |
Устройство для обслуживания запросов | 1987 |
|
SU1492354A1 |
Устройство для обслуживания запросов | 1984 |
|
SU1196870A1 |
Авторы
Даты
1981-07-15—Публикация
1979-10-08—Подача